Hello everyone! Let me introduce the finished version of the Concrete Pump machine. It has several differences from the orifinal vehicle so I/m not sure I can let myself to call this Putzmeister M70. All photos: https://bricksafe.com/pages/Aleh/putzmeister-m70 Tractor truck is a Kenworth C500B: - Full suspension - 3 real driven axles by two XL Motors. - Two steered axles at a different angle - i6 engine - openable hood and doors - Pump for compressed air for operations with the boom the boom (L motor) Trailer is a pump itself. - 3 rolling simple axles - Two manual outriggers with 3 manual functions. - 4-Section boom: two are operated by L motors independently and two other by the lego pneumatics. - 2 Rear LED Two Sbricks for managing the motors.
